Sebastian Herbszt wrote:
> Jan Kiszka wrote:
>> This patch changes the boot command line option to the canonical format
>>
>>  -boot [order=]drives[,interactive=on|off]
>>
>> where 'drives' is using the same format as the old -boot. The format
>> switch allows to add the 'interactive' option and use the existing
>> infrastructure to parse it. However, the old format is still understood
>> and will be processed at least for a transition time.
>>
>> The state of 'interactive' is transfered to the firmware via the new
>> configuration value FW_CFG_BOOT_INTERACTIVE.
> 
> What about using "[boot]menu" instead of "interactive"?
> The Phoenix BIOS i got here allows me to enable/disable the boot menu,
> so this seems common.

Yes, short is beautiful. Will sent out a new series, addressing all
suggestions made so far.
